Brick stoop repair services focus on restoring the stability, appearance, and safety of the entryway steps made from brick. Over time, exposure to weather, foot traffic, and natural settling can cause bricks to crack, shift, or become uneven. Repair work typically involves replacing damaged bricks, re-leveling the steps, and filling in cracks or gaps to prevent further deterioration. This process helps maintain the curb appeal of a property while ensuring that the stoop remains a secure and functional entrance for residents and visitors alike.
Many common problems lead homeowners to seek brick stoop repairs. Cracks in the bricks can develop due to temperature fluctuations or ground movement, creating tripping hazards and reducing the structural integrity of the steps. Uneven or sunken brickwork may result from soil settling or erosion beneath the stoop. Additionally, mortar joints can deteriorate over time, leading to loose bricks and potential safety concerns. Addressing these issues promptly can prevent more extensive damage and costly repairs down the line.

The overview below groups typical Brick Stoop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Wadsworth,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or brick stoop repairs in Wadsworth range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es, such as replacing a few damaged bricks or re-sealing the surface, fall within this band. Fewer projects reach the upper end of this range, which usually involves additional work or materials.
Moderate Repairs - For more extensive repairs like rebuilding sections of the stoop or addressing foundational issues, local contractors often charge between $600 and $2,000. This range covers most mid-sized projects that require partial reconstruction or significant mortar work.
Full Replacement - Replacing an entire brick stoop can typically cost from $2,500 to $5,000 or more, depending on size and complexity. Larger, more intricate projects, such as custom designs or extensive foundation work, can push costs beyond this range.
Complex or Custom Projects - Very large or complex stoop repairs, including custom designs or structural reinforcements, can exceed $5,000. These projects are less common and often involve specialized materials or extensive labor, leading to higher cost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es brick stoop damage? Common causes include settling foundations, moisture infiltration, and freeze-thaw cycles that weaken mortar joints and brick integrity.
How can I tell if my brick stoop needs repair? Signs include cracked or crumbling bricks, loose or missing mortar, and uneven or sagging surfaces that indicate structural issues.
What types of repairs do local contractors provide for brick stoops? Services often include repointing mortar joints, replacing damaged bricks, leveling uneven surfaces, and restoring overall stability.
